Suicide Prevention and Risk Management

Schools maximize academic success by ensuring student safety through comprehensive suicide prevention and risk management. Organized under the Multi-Tiered System of Supports (MTSS) framework, this work spans from universal prevention—like staff training, student curriculum, and screenings—to direct intervention, including immediate risk assessments, parent notifications, safety planning, and crisis response. By structuring care this way, schools establish a seamless safety net that connects vulnerable individuals to ongoing community resources and mitigates post-crisis risks like contagion.
